Turkmenistan Travel Guides offer valuable information and insights for travelers planning to explore this Central Asian country. These guides typically cover a range of topics related to Turkmenistan, including its culture, history, geography, attractions, and practical travel tips. Here are some key points you might find in a Turkmenistan travel guide:

  1. Introduction to Turkmenistan: These guides often start with an overview of the country, including its location, capital city (Ashgabat), and its historical significance in the region.

  2. History and Culture: Turkmenistan has a rich history and a unique culture influenced by its nomadic heritage and various conquerors. Travel guides delve into these aspects, providing readers with insights into the country's past and traditions.

  3. Top Attractions: Guides typically highlight the must-visit places in Turkmenistan.This can include ancient cities like Merv and Nisa, the Darvaza Gas Crater (known as the "Door to Hell"), and various architectural landmarks in Ashgabat.

  4. Travel Tips: Practical information is essential for travelers. Guides include details on visa requirements, currency, language, and local customs. They may also provide advice on transportation options within the country.

  5. Accommodations and Dining: Information on hotels, guesthouses, and restaurants is often included, helping travelers choose suitable places to stay and dine.

  6. Activities and Outdoor Adventures: Turkmenistan offers opportunities for outdoor enthusiasts, such as trekking in the Kopet Dag Mountains or experiencing the unique landscapes of the Karakum Desert. Travel guides may outline these activities and provide tips for enjoying them safely.

  7. Safety and Health: Guides generally include safety recommendations and health advice, such as vaccinations and precautions against extreme weather conditions.

  8. Language and Communication: Information on the Turkmen language and common phrases can be useful for travelers who want to engage with locals.

  9. Cultural Etiquette: Understanding local customs and etiquette is crucial to respecting the culture. Travel guides often provide insights into how to behave appropriately in Turkmenistan.

  10. Maps and Transportation: Detailed maps of Turkmenistan and information about getting around the country are typically featured in these guides.

  11. Photography and Souvenirs: Tips on photography and suggestions for unique souvenirs to bring back home may also be included.

  12. Current Events and Updates: Since conditions in countries can change, travel guides may offer updates on the latest developments or news affecting travelers in Turkmenistan.

Turkmenistan is known for its unique and relatively lesser-known tourist destinations, so a comprehensive travel guide can be a valuable resource for those interested in exploring this fascinating part of Asia.
